All lanes : Anti-SESN1 antibody [EPR1930(2)] (ab134091) at 1/1000 dilution (Purified)
Lane 1 : Human heart lysates
Lane 2 : K-562 (Human chronic myelogenous leukemia lymphoblast) whole cell lysates
Lane 3 : F9 (Mouse embryonal carcinoma epithelial cell) whole cell lysates
Lane 4 : C2C12 (Mouse myoblasts myoblast) whole cell lysates
Lane 5 : NIH/3T3 (Mouse embryonic fibroblast) whole cell lysates
Lane 6 : Rat heart lysates
Lysates/proteins at 15 µg per lane.
Secondary
All lanes : Goat Anti-Rabbit IgG H&L (HRP) (ab97051) at 1/20000 dilution
Predicted band size: 57 kDa
Observed band size: 65 kDa why is the actual band size different from the predicted?The bands observed are consistent with what has been described in PMID: 29751091 and PMID: 29263116

Flow Cytometry analysis of Daudi (Human Burkitt's lymphoma lymphoblast) cells treated with 20 U/ml IFN alpha 1 for 24 hours (Red) / Untreated control (Green) labelling Anti-SESN1 with unpurified ab207414 at 1/600 dilution. Cells were fixed with 2% paraformaldehyde. A Goat anti rabbit IgG (Alexa Fluor® 488, ab150077) was used as the secondary antibody. Black - isotype control, Rabbit monoclonal IgG (ab172730). Blue -unlabelled control, cells without incubation with primary and secondary antibodies.
